The chairman of the PNV, Andoni Ortuzarand the leader of JxCat and former president of the Generalitat of Catalonia, Carlos Puigdemontmet today in Belgium to “strengthen relations” and tackle the investiture negotiations, “taking into account that both parties played a key role after the 23rd elections.”
The meeting, which represents the first official contact between Ortuzar and Puigdemont, took place in Waterloo, at the former Catalan president’s residence in Belgium, and Joseba Aurrekoetxea (PNV) and Jordi Turull (JxCat) also participated.
As the PNV explains in a note, the meeting was “very cordial and useful” to “intensify and optimize relations between both parties and between Euskadi and Catalonia.”
“On the other hand, we have also logically spent a large part of our time sharing our analysis of the current political situation, taking into account that both parties have played a key role in the elections of June 23. with a view to a possible investiture. In short, we had an interesting exchange of views on the negotiations that have not yet started,” the Jeltzale formation concluded.
